About Washington Elementary School

Washington Elementary School is a public elementary school in Bergenfield, NJ, part of Bergenfield Borough School District. Washington Elementary School serves approximately 257 students, and covers grades Kindergarten-5th, and has a 12.2:1 student-teacher ratio. Washington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.0 out of 10 and ranks #1,466 of 2,466 schools in NJ.

Structured state assessment records for Washington Elementary School show 61%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 62%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about Washington Elementary School

What grades does Washington Elementary School serve?

Washington Elementary School serves students in grades Kindergarten through 5th.

How many students attend Washington Elementary School?

Washington Elementary School has an enrollment of approximately 257 students.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Washington Elementary School?

The student-teacher ratio at Washington Elementary School is 12.2: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 16:1 for public schools.

How does Washington Elementary School rank in NJ?

Washington Elementary School ranks #1,466 of 2,466 schools in NJ.

What is Washington Elementary School's MySchoolScout rating?

Washington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.0 out of 10. This score combines the level-appropriate components shown in the rating breakdown; equity data is shown separately for context.

What are the test scores at Washington Elementary School?

Based on loaded state assessment records, Washington Elementary School has 61%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 62%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

Is Washington Elementary School a charter school?

No, Washington Elementary School is not a charter school. It is a traditional public school operated by the local school district.

Is Washington Elementary School a Title I school?

No, Washington Elementary School is not currently a Title I school.

What does the Free & Reduced Lunch percentage mean for Washington Elementary School?

36.6% of students at Washington Elementary School q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. This is a commonly used indicator of economic need and provides important context when interpreting test scores.
